A Why Bother Tree Christmas
Scene: BOB and BECKY have come over to BOB's brother, LARRY'S apartment to drop off his present on Chrsitmas Eve. The place is in absoulute chaos. They soon find out that there is order to disorder.
LARRY: (Closing the door after they walk in) You're here! Welcome! I mean Merry Christmas!
BOB: Merry Christmas, Larry! What has it been 3 - 4 years?
BECKY: Merry Christmas, Larry (She gives him a little hug) So, when did you move into this place?
LARRY: About 2 years ago! Right after the divorce. It's 3 bedrooms! Want the tour?
BECKY: There's more of this?
LARRY: Well! I could probably live in a one bedroom and then sleep on the couch when the kids came to visit, but the State said that after the divorce the kids had to have their own bedrooms so I had to find a place this big.
BECKY: Did the court say something about straightening...
BOB: Sooooo! When do the kids come in for Christmas?
LARRY: After New Year's! Kaye and her new husband are taking Jenny and Frank skiing over the holidays! So I'll get to see them sometime after the New Years.
BECKY: Really? That's sad!
LARRY: It's OK. I've been working a lot in order to keep busy. Speaking of keeping busy, let me go back in the kitchen and stir my noodles. You kind of caught me off guard here. Move one of those stacks of papers and grab a seat on the sofa! I'll be right back. (He exits to the kitchen)
BOB: (Moving a stack of newspapers) Come on honey! Sit down!
BECKY: He has newspapers all over the living room. And look at that tree. Come over here, Honey! Look at this tree! There are beer cans... and a pizza box... tinsel...wait! That's not tinsel, its the wrapping off of pop tarts. There are some old love song CDs as ornaments. This is one a sad tree. And look around the room. He hung that garland up, but look at all the animal cartoon drawings he interlaced in it. He is a pig! Sheila must have been the one to keep that big old house so clean. This is really sad. Really really sad.
BOB: It is a mess! I feel sorry for the kids!
BECKY: I can only imagine what their rooms look like. Oh, this is terrible. And here we are coming over here to tell him about your new job and it looks like he just sits around here all day doing nothing! Well! Don't let him borrow any money! Whaever you do, don't do that!
BOB: He made runway lights on the ceiling with Christmas lights... all the way down the hallway!
